TV and Film Production Course
Award: Certificate or Diploma
Duration: 1 Year (Certificate) or 2 Years (Diploma)
Year 2 is also available as a top-up
Start Dates: September 2010 & March 2011
Fees: £3985 per year or monthly installments of £365 (Price applicable to applications from 1st July 2010)

Course Objectives
This course is designed to give students a solid understanding of the production and post production process for the film and television industries.
Students develop the knowledge and skills required to produce content for television programmes, commercials, music videos and feature films.
Where will this course lead me?
Successful graduates leave the course equipped with the essential skills needed in both the film and post production industries.
Possible employment opportunities include Offline Editor, Digitizer, Edit Assistant, Online Editor, Single camera operator,
Lighting assistant, Title editor & Runner. You will be able to shoot, edit and produce content to broadcast standard.

Who is the course for?
Year 1 starts from first principles, so is suitable for beginners. Year 2 progresses your skills to advanced
level, and is suitable for year 1 graduates, degree post graduates and those with relevant experience or education
seeking to advance their knowledge.
Are there any pre-requisites?
Year 1: No formal qualifications are required
Year 2: We accept direct entry onto year 2, providing you have relevant experience or
education that can be demonstrated with a portfolio at interview. Yr 1 graduates are
automatically accepted onto year 2.
When Will I Study?
2 x 3 hour lectures (7-10pm) plus 10 hours individual studio time per week.
